The new has come! Put away the old!!! VAP(TA) works with some assumptions that I tend not to agree with. I personally think the tool is more suited for currencies, crypto and commodities hence good for traders. Investors need more..... With our own peculiarities in Naija, you will need a lot of FA also to survive NSE. The best situation is if you are good at both and can combine the two. People like @Rabbi and co. use both with good results. |

Mcy56: Let me add this: Instead of watching out for the info to sell alone, why not also have your own strategy or follow what works best for you? If you're for JIJO, then you may just target a certain percentage, say 10 or 15%, when you achieve it, just sell it OR, when you reach target and you still think you can gain more, you can then start watching out for price resistance and sell as soon as you noticed this.
NB: note the word jijo there. No vex say I put mouth for the matter o.  About 95% of my portfolio on medium term. 5% on Jijo. I have made right decisions and several wrongs calls several times.
